Introduction
What is Server-Side Tracking?
Server-Side Tracking involves collecting user data during the visit to a web page by routing it from the web server, which delivers these pages, to a destination server where the data will be processed.
Client-Side vs Server-Side tracking
To fully grasp the benefits of server-side tracking, it is essential to understand the functioning of the traditional tracking model: client-side tracking.
With client-side tracking, data is collected directly from JavaScript tags embedded on web pages and executed in the user's browser. This raw data is then sent to analytics and advertising tools.
The limitations of client-side tracking are numerous:
A large number of HTTP requests to process for the site, resulting in an overload of code to execute, which increases loading time and degrades overall performance.
Raw, unprocessed data is transmitted directly from the user's browser, which exposes it to security risks.
Inconsistencies in data can occur for various reasons, such as ad blockers or network issues.
Maintenance issues and scalability difficulties of the tool due to the intervention of third parties.
In contrast, server-side tracking overcomes these limitations by offering:
Better data control as it is processed, deduplicated, and corrected before being sent to analytics and advertising platforms, ensuring more qualified and relevant data.
Complete independence from third-party cookies, allowing for enriching data collection even after 2025.
Reduced data loss by bypassing ad blockers and anti-tracking systems, providing more comprehensive audience insights to improve marketing actions.
Simplified consent management, with data filtering and anonymization to retain only the necessary information.
Improved site performance, thanks to reduced code volume and faster loading speed, leading to a better user experience.
Server-side tracking also allows tracking of events that do not occur on the site, such as payment confirmation on a third-party platform. It offers the possibility to connect a CRM to optimize targeting and creates a solid foundation for marketing automation and analysis. This tool enables a more holistic and precise management of marketing performance.
Components of Server-Side Tracking
As mentioned, server-side tracking is a process that begins as soon as a user interacts with web content; the event is triggered, and the script is sent server-side. The data is then first sent to the destination server, where it is processed, cleaned, and enriched before being transmitted to appropriate analytics or marketing platforms. This method enhances data accuracy and security by minimizing client-side vulnerabilities.
The 4 main components of server-side tagging are:
- Data collection: Capturing user interactions via scripts embedded on web pages.
- Data processing: Cleaning, deduplicating, and enriching data before transmission.
- Data storage: Securely storing data on the server for future use.
- Data transmission: Sending processed data to analytics and marketing platforms.
The 3 Major Reasons to Switch to Server-Side Tracking
Privacy and Security
With new government measures, server-side tracking becomes legally unavoidable. It helps businesses achieve better compliance with regulations like GDPR or CCPA and ensures enhanced data protection. Companies gain better control over user information, enhancing security and limiting risks of data breaches.
Performance and Reliability
One of the key advantages of server-side tracking is its ability to boost website performance by reducing the volume of HTTP requests. This not only speeds up site loading times but also ensures more accurate data collection by bypassing ad blockers and anti-tracking systems.
Control and Data Flexibility
Server-side tracking allows for more advanced personalization in user communication through greater granularity and better control over collected data. By filtering and enriching data before analysis or use in audience targeting, businesses ensure the retention and exploitation of high-quality data.
Deployment of Server-Side Tracking with Google Tag Manager and Google Analytics 4
Setting Up a Server-Side Container in GTM
Google offers its own server-side tracking solution with GTM Server-Side, fully integrated into the Google ecosystem, which simplifies its configuration and usage. The tool also provides great flexibility in tag configuration and data processing. In terms of costs, this solution offers a more advantageous pricing compared to the rest of the market.
What are the steps to start with server-side tagging in GTM?
- Create a new server-side container in GTM.
- Configure the server domain and security settings.
- Define tags and triggers to capture desired events.
- Test the configuration to ensure that data is correctly collected (i.e., respecting user choices) and transmitted.
These steps are integral to establishing an effective tracking plan, ensuring systematic and accurate implementation of data tracking.
Some examples of common tags and triggers:
- Conversion tracking tags
- Custom event tags
- Triggers based on specific user actions
Why is it important to create synergy between server-side tracking and your analytics tools?
Server-side tracking enables higher data quality through centralized processing and allows for greater customization of reports and analyses. By combining this with web tracking, you obtain a more comprehensive view of user behavior. Overall, integrating all marketing tools is much smoother when opting for Google tools.
Exploring Advanced Server-Side Tracking Management
Managing the Data Layer on the Server
To ensure that collected information is optimally utilized, it's crucial to methodically organize the management of the Data Layer. Two main aspects should be considered:
Data organization, structured in logical layers:
Thoughtful segmentation to facilitate management and analysis
Standardized data formats for easier integration with other tools
Hierarchical data with priority levels to enable more efficient processing.
Optimizing data flows:
Minimizing latency, compressing data, and implementing caching to reduce server load.
Server Security Management
A significant advantage of server-side tagging is the ability to configure data security effectively and implement necessary measures to ensure it:
Establishing a robust security protocol with:
- Encryption to secure data in transit and at rest
- Strong authentication mechanisms and granular access control
- Monitoring and logging all access attempts to prevent suspicious activities.
Continuous access monitoring through:
Regular audits to address potential vulnerabilities
Role-based access management
Regular security updates.
Debugging and Testing Server-Side Implementations
To ensure accurate data collection and reporting, effective tools and techniques for debugging and testing server-side implementations are essential:
Using debugging tools to identify and resolve issues:
- Monitoring tools
- Detailed logs
- Automated testing tools.
Implementing regular tests to ensure data credibility:
Verifying each system component functions correctly and integrates well.
Conducting load tests to ensure the system handles high data volumes without performance degradation.
Ensuring tracking systems comply with regulations and industry standards.
By applying these practices, businesses ensure efficient, secure, and reliable server-side tracking, enabling informed decision-making for future marketing actions.
Conclusion
The end of third-party cookies announced for early 2025 will mark a decisive turning point for the world of digital marketing, complicating data collection and personalized communications. Server-side tracking emerges as the key solution to meet these new challenges. With improved control, enhanced security, and optimized performance, server-side tagging enables businesses to maintain a data-driven approach in their marketing strategies while adhering to data protection regulations.
In the coming years, server-side tracking will continue to evolve, integrating new technologies such as AI and machine learning. Predictive analytics and deeper insights are likely to become more accessible. However, along with new opportunities come new challenges, particularly in maintaining data security.
By adopting these new methods, you are preparing for a future that promises smarter, more secure, and more efficient data tracking. Engaging a specialized agency in server-side tracking can provide expert guidance and facilitate the deployment of such projects. Our team is ready to assist you in this transition and provide essential support to navigate the rapidly evolving digital landscape. Contact us today to start the discussion!